Ingredients for Smoky Peanut Butter Chili Recipe

vegan chili companion.

Here’s what you’ll need to make this delicious dish:

  • Ground Beef or Turkey: Use about 1 pound for a hearty base; turkey offers a lighter option if preferred.
  • Onion: One medium onion adds sweetness and depth; make sure it’s diced finely for even cooking.
  • Bell Peppers: Choose colorful bell peppers (red, yellow, or green) for both flavor and visual appeal.
  • Canned Tomatoes: A 14-ounce can of diced tomatoes provides acidity and balance; opt for low-sodium if you’re watching salt intake.
  • Peanut Butter: Creamy or crunchy peanut butter brings richness; choose natural varieties without added sugars for the best flavor.
  • Smoked Paprika: This spice gives the chili its distinctive smoky flavor; don’t skip it!
  • Chili Powder: About two tablespoons will give your chili a nice kick; adjust based on your heat preference.
  • Vegetable Broth: Use about two cups; it helps create the perfect consistency while adding flavor.

Storing & Reheating

Store leftovers in an airtight container in the fridge for up to five days. To reheat, simply warm on the stove over low heat, stirring occasionally. Add a splash of water if it thickens too much—nobody likes gluey chili!

Ingredients

Scale
  • 1 lb ground beef or turkey
  • 1 medium onion, diced
  • 2 bell peppers (any color), diced
  • 14 oz canned diced tomatoes
  • ½ cup creamy natural peanut butter
  • 2 tsp smoked paprika
  • 2 tbsp chili powder
  • 2 cups vegetable broth

Instructions

  1. In a large pot, heat olive oil over medium heat; sauté the diced onion until translucent (about 5 minutes).
  2. Add ground meat and cook until browned (approximately 8 minutes). Drain excess fat.
  3. Stir in bell peppers and optional garlic; cook for another 5 minutes until tender.
  4. Mix in smoked paprika and chili powder before adding canned tomatoes and vegetable broth.
  5. Stir in peanut butter until fully incorporated; reduce heat and simmer for 20 minutes, stirring occasionally.
  6. Serve hot, garnished with cilantro or avocado slices if desired.
